Development description
Planning permission is sought for a proposed single storey extension to the rear of lurganboy lodge, internal refurbishment works, alterations to the east gable, three new heritage roof lights, the fitting of a flat iron gate on the passageway on the west side and a new rear patio and seating at lurganboy lodge, barrack park td. , lurganboy, co leitrim, f91 p6x8. The lurganboy lodge is a protected structure, rps no 274
